Itinerary: The Golden Triangle

ONE WEEK

This classic Delhi-Agra-Jaipur route, affectionately dubbed 'The Golden Triangle,' takes you to some of India's most renowned sights, including the iconic Taj Mahal. Beginning and ending in India's bustling capital, Delhi, this itinerary is especially suited to those who have limited time in North India.

This much-loved Delhi-Agra-Jaipur jaunt starts and ends at the Golden Triangle's 'tip', Delhi. You can cover this route in a week, but a few extra days are recommended.

On day one immerse yourself in history at Delhi's National Museum and Humayun's Tomb before shop-hopping.

On day two ramble around Old Delhi's historic Red Fort and Jama Masjid before diving into the old city's rambunctious bazaars.

On day three make an early morning start southeast for Agra so you have adequate time at the enchanting Taj Mahal and Agra Fort.

Spend day four wandering around the fortified ghost city of Fatehpur Sikri and, if time permits, sneak a peek at Akbar's Mausoleum.

On day five start early for Jaipur to check out its medley of sights.

Spend day six exploring Amber, 11km north of Jaipur, and nearby Jaigarh, before haggling for souvenirs back at Jaipur's spirited bazaars.

On day seven return to Delhi.
